Pests & Diseases
Gourds share powdery and downy mildews, bacterial wilt, anthracnose, and gummy stem blight with other cucurbits. Control cucumber beetles early, rotate the crop, and choose resistant varieties where offered. Discard fruit with soft lesions; only fully sound, cured gourds should be kept for crafts or seed.
Monitor gourd for squash bugs, cucumber beetles, vine borers, and mites. Inspect stems and leaf undersides, handpick adults and eggs, and remove severely damaged vines.
